Invisible Sims, and broken base game hairs

I just switched from Origin to the EA App and now and sim younger than a teenager is invisible. As well as swatches of specific base game hairs being broken. I have removed all mods and cc from my game.I have tried to reset the sim, change their outfit, and restart the game many times. Even in cas infants, toddlers, and children are invisible.

    I suggest you try a user folder reset first.  Just rename the "The Sims 4" folder to something else or move it somewhere safe outside the "Electronic Arts" folder.  Then start the game and create a new save.  Check to see if the issue is still there when you make the new sim.  I'd suggest you make at least one of each age.  Once you've made the new sims and placed them, play them for a few minutes to see if they are visible.  Then save and quit.

    If you find all the sims and the things you noticed that were broken before aren't anymore, then you'll need to check your old save to see if the problem is still there. So, copy your save from the old "The Sims 4" folder to the new one.  Start the game and see if the problem is still there.  Don't save when you quit.  If at this point, everything looks as it should, then your issue is either an outdated mod or broken CC which you'll have to hunt down and either update, replace or remove.

    In addition to repairing the game as @luthienrising suggests, are you using the ICloud?  If you are, you need to make sure everything associated with the game is on your computer rather than in the cloud.  The game does not like the cloud.  So, make sure you have both the program files and your user files excluded from using the cloud.

    Switching from Origin to the EA App doesn't change anything about the game.  The only things that are affected by the switch is Origin, which gets removed, and the App, which gets installed.  The game files, both the program files and the user files are not touched in the transition.
